About Triethanolamine



Triethanolamine is a versatile chemical compound with a molecular formula of C6H15NO3 and a molecular weight of 149.188 grams. It appears as a colorless liquid and is fully miscible in water, showcasing its excellent solubility properties. With a melting point of 21.60 C (70.88 F), this compound is primarily utilized as a pH adjuster in various industrial and manufacturing processes. Triethanolamine is produced through the reaction of ethylene oxide with ammonia, both of which are considered toxic substances. Beyond its pH adjustment capabilities, it also serves as a buffering agent, masking ingredient, fragrance component, and surfactant. These diverse functions make Triethanolamine critical for applications in products requiring precise chemical balance and enhanced functionality.
